Lessons On Sales And Customer Relationships: Be Quick But Don't Hurry

Legendary Coach John Wooden Would Use This Phrase To Motivate His Teams Growing up I often heard my dad say; “Be quick, but don’t hurry.” He was quoting the famous UCLA men’s basketball coach, John Wooden, who won a record 10 national championships in 12 years. I would have never guessed it at the time, but this lesson at an early age has proven foundational for all aspects of my life, especially when it comes to sales and customer relationships. These words echo in my mind today as I think about how my dad tried to impart to my brother and me the value of a strong  work ethic  and persistence. It rankled him to watch a job done poorly just because someone was lazy and inefficient. He loathed a rushed process, cut corners, or when people scraped by doing the bare minimum.
